Running this test:

use std::sync::mpsc::channel;
use std::thread;

fn main() {
    let (tx, rx) = channel::<i32>();
    let _t = thread::spawn(move || {
        drop(rx);
    });
    let _ = thread::spawn(move || {
        tx.send(1).unwrap();
    })
    .join();
}

with many different seeds in Miri eventually shows:

This indicates that the allocation made here does not get freed properly:

let new = Box::into_raw(Box::new(Block::<T>::new()));

Specifically when running this with Miri 3fe10973bb6e9a01b280686534d0242da07f3ede, seed 139 causes the issue.

I don't think there is any way for this to be a false positive.

I think this is not recent, it's just hard to trigger. I'll try reproducing on some older versions of rustc+Miri:

  • 1244dca7fd35293b5c88d51efea781cb566d8cfe (Jan 24th): seed 1870
  • cad4f40616ccf4ada87506ec5437b2ff41af2671 (Nov 22nd, 2023): seed 1020

We can't go back much further since it seems we're not keeping the artifacts long enough for that?

So probably this existed ever since #93563 landed.
